Common Tree Pruning Jobs
Tree pruning - shaping trees to improve their appearance and structure.
Deadwood removal - eliminating dead or diseased branches to promote healthy growth.
Thinning - reducing branch density to increase sunlight and airflow through the canopy.
Crown reduction - reducing the size of the tree's canopy to prevent overgrowth and hazards.
Form pruning - maintaining or developing the natural shape of trees for aesthetic and health reasons.
Storm damage pruning - removing broken or hazardous branches after severe weather events.
Tree Pruning Questions
What is tree pruning? Tree pruning involves removing specific branches or parts of a tree to improve its health, shape, and safety.
Why is tree pruning important? Proper pruning helps maintain tree stability, encourages healthy growth, and reduces the risk of falling branches.
When is the best time to prune trees? The optimal time to prune is typically during late winter or early spring before new growth begins.
What types of trees benefit from pruning? Most deciduous and evergreen trees benefit from pruning to promote structure and remove dead or damaged limbs.
